West Bengal: School reopens despite government order, conducts examination for students

Flouting the West Bengal government’s order, a school reopened in Budge Budge. Not only that, examinations were also conducted in the school for students. Many people were shocked when the incident came to light. However, school authorities admitted to disobeying government guidelines. Prominent people have demanded the administration take appropriate action against the private school named MIM Academy.
